The Cathedral of Seville has been from ancient times not only the heart of the sevillians’ spiritual life, but also the heart of their commercial life.

Around this monument developed the most important episodes of the people of the city of Seville, and, before it, it was the mosque that governed the life of the citizens.

Declared by the Unesco World Heritage in 1989 , is one of the most important monuments in the city. A visit full of surprises and wonderful historical facts.
